First visit to this Robinsons run pub just off the main street, we missed this one last year as it appeared to be very foodie.

It does sell food and at 6.30pm was doing a good trade but it also has 6 hand pumps with 6 ales on 4 from Robinsons and 2 from Hartley's, I had a pint of their Cumbrian XB @ 4.0%.

The down stairs is where the bar is along with seating areas for drinkers and diners, upstairs there's more of a restaurant area.

Music playing at a decent level. Good attentive service, pictures of the local area and well known local people & a well kept ale.
